Wow! I pre-dated you a bit as my first car was a 1963 MGB- black with red leather interior, chrome wire wheels, electric overdrive on 3rd & 4th gear, and a Blaupunkt radio and a tonneau cover. It only had 7500 miles in it & the engine had been blueprinted (That should have been a clue to it's past....) that my Dad found at Import Motors in Lubbock, Texas in 1965. We took it for a drive & I LOVED that car! It was beautiful, and it WAS FAST!!! Unfortunately, I found out the transmission was a weak link, when I blew it up(racing).....and we were told it would take six to nine months to get parts....and it was gone!! I was back on foot, I saw it back on the street 15 day's later, then found out the first owner had been a pilot at Reese AirForce base in Lubbock and had bought it to race and had traded it in on a Jaguar because of the weak transmission.
You live and learn, and BOY, do I ever wish I had taken a picture with that MGB!

I have the worst car so far. My first car was a 1984 Audi 5000s that was a canary yellow with brown iterior. I payed 1000 bucks for it. The car was interesting let me tell you it had a slant 5 cyl motor which I think is just weird. It was a 5 speed too. The car had no power steering it had a power rack a pinion which took a oil that was like 20 bucks a quart and you can only get at the audi or porsche dealer. The window was held up by a curtain rod in the door and the sunroof was stuck halfway open. When the car broke you are really broke because you need to take out a mortage to fix it. Those damn germans build some crappy cars.
